Master Jeong, Ridgefield
Master Jeong (email) is a fifth degree black belt and holds a Bachelors degree in Physical Education with a Tae Kwon Do major from Kyung Hee University. He also holds a Masters degree in Secondary Physical Education from Dong Kuk University. While in university he issued a thesis titled 'The influence of children who learned Tae Kwon Do versus the children that didn't.' His research found that children who participated in Tae Kwon Do had a better a sense of self-esteem and respect versus the children that didn't learn Tae Kwon Do. Master Jeong was one of the top athletes in Korea, having won over 15 gold medals at national and international competitions. One of these gold medals was at the 2002 Yeo-Su Tae Kwon Do World Championships. Master Jeong was a professional Tae Kwon Do competitor for the most prestigious professional team in Korea (Kogas Gas Company) from 2002-2004. He was also member of the Korean national team in 2001.
